    I am new here and hope i will have the opportunity to get to know all of you. Since a few months i am experimenting with vcd and work this way :
    1. copy the dvd to hd using smartripper
    2. encoding to mpeg1 (high bitrates between 1500-2000) with dvdx and tmpegenc, which is giving satisfying picture to me
    3. burn the movie to 2 vcd's that can be played in my home dvd player

    Now i was wondering, with the dvd writers coming soon...
    Is it possible to burn the moviempeg (mentioned above and between 1 and 2 gig big) to dvdr as a so called vcd so that i have a vcd disc with 4,7 gig of space ?
    The advantage would be that the movie is on 1 disc instead of 2-3

  2. As far as I know it is possible, but you will need to have an Audio at 48khz and not the VCD standard of 44.1khz, and it should be accepted by most if not all DVD Authoring programs.
